Phuket teacher crisis appeal sparks flood of applicants

Phuket Gazette

phuket-1-11456GcZXuaBsqWPBegeyjuTxrRcNoG.jpg

More English teachers are needed at Phuket schools.

PHUKET: -- The Director of the Phuket Primary Educational Office has called for all people wanting to apply for positions as English teachers at government schools in Phuket Town to contact the schools directly.

Dr Jian Thongnoon announced the news in the wake of the Phuket Gazette posting online its story about the shortage of English teachers at Phuket schools reaching what local officials are calling “crisis level”.

Since posting the story online, the Gazette has received a constant stream of requests for contact information about where to apply.

“I would like to inform all foreigners who are interested and qualified to be a teacher to personally go to any primary school to apply for the position,” Dr Jian told the Gazette.

“The Phuket Primary Educational Service Office does not have a database of the positions vacant at each primary school. But we have been providing extra grants for all schools in Phuket since the beginning of the new semester [late October] so schools can hire more English teachers,” he said.

Dr Jian urged applicants to give government schools priority in applying.

“I would like them to focus on government schools. Private schools and international schools have enough foreign teachers, but we still need a lot more at government schools,” he said.

Dr Jian urged anyone interested in applying for teaching positions at the government schools to visit the Phuket Primary Educational Service Office website here:

http://www.pkt.obec.go.th/data/phuket/nameschool.html

He advised that for those who cannot read Thai, applicants should use the contact information in the top two categories on the web page.
